[PULL 39/49] ppc/pnv: Add POWER9/10 chiptod model


From: Nicholas Piggin
Subject: [PULL 39/49] ppc/pnv: Add POWER9/10 chiptod model
Date: Mon, 19 Feb 2024 18:29:28 +1000

The ChipTOD (for Time-Of-Day) is a chip pervasive facility in IBM POWER
(powernv) processors that keeps a time of day clock.

In particular for this model are facilities that initialise and start
the time of day clock, and that synchronise that clock to cores on the
chip, and to other chips. In this way, all cores on all chips can
synchronise timebase (TB).

This model implements functionality sufficient to run the skiboot
chiptod synchronisation procedure (with the following core timebase
state machine implementation). It does not modify the TB in the cores
where the real hardware would, because the QEMU ppc timebase
implementation is always synchronised acros all cores.

+/*
+ * QEMU PowerPC PowerNV Emulation of some ChipTOD behaviour
+ *
+ * Copyright (c) 2022-2023, IBM Corporation.
+ *
+ * S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0-or-later
+ *
+ * ChipTOD (aka TOD) is a facility implemented in the nest / pervasive. The
+ * purpose is to keep time-of-day across chips and cores.
+ *
+ * There is a master chip TOD, which sends signals to slave chip TODs to
+ * keep them synchronized. There are two sets of configuration registers
+ * called primary and secondary, which can be used fail over.
+ *
+ * The chip TOD also distributes synchronisation signals to the timebase
+ * facility in each of the cores on the chip. In particular there is a
+ * feature that can move the TOD value in the ChipTOD to and from the TB.
+ *
+ * Initialisation typically brings all ChipTOD into sync (see tod_state),
+ * and then brings each core TB into sync with the ChipTODs (see timebase
+ * state and TFMR). This model is a very basic simulation of the init sequence
+ * performed by skiboot.
+ */

+/*
+ * The TOD FSM:
+ * - The reset state is 0 error.
+ * - A hardware error detected will transition to state 0 from any state.
+ * - LOAD_TOD_MOD and TTYPE5 will transition to state 7 from any state.
+ *
+ * | state      | action                       | new |
+ * |------------+------------------------------+-----|
+ * | 0 error    | LOAD_TOD_MOD                 |  7  |
+ * | 0 error    | Recv TTYPE5 (invalidate TOD) |  7  |
+ * | 7 not_set  | LOAD_TOD (bit-63 = 0)        |  2  |
+ * | 7 not_set  | LOAD_TOD (bit-63 = 1)        |  1  |
+ * | 7 not_set  | Recv TTYPE4 (send TOD)       |  2  |
+ * | 2 running  |                              |     |
+ * | 1 stopped  | START_TOD                    |  2  |
+ *
+ * Note the hardware has additional states but they relate to the sending
+ * and receiving and waiting on synchronisation signals between chips and
+ * are not described or modeled here.
+ */
